Output 344924082af77f9427f581f3dc917aa17d964c58a476d9473b53cf99eaa79538:0

value
12318273
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5710939eda3e7234e65fb61d103c03d3b187bf1 OP_EQUALVERIFY OP_CHECKSIG
address
1HYNibyi7P2MccqERKH4Zb4u6qJky62uYj
transaction
344924082af77f9427f581f3dc917aa17d964c58a476d9473b53cf99eaa79538
spent
true